Summary

The novel starts when Narccissa Malfoy time Travels in the future to hide Delphini Riddle the daughter of lord Voldemort. She and her loyal servant Argos Noir a werewolf hand over Delphi to an orphanage nun and force her to make an unbreakable vow that she will keep Delphi healthy and happy, she will send Delphi to Hogwarts when she turns 11 and after her graduation she will tell Delphi about her real parents Lord Voldemort and Dahlia Black. Elen years later Draco Malfoy wakes up from a nightmare recalling the story of Delphi’s birth and the Death of her Mother Dahlia Black. He explains how Dahlia was a Squib who was left alone by her mother Belllatrix Lestrange after her lover left her. He also explains how Dahlia was brought to Malfoy Manner as a slave to be used by lord Voldemort in a ritual and create a child. However Dahlia dies a few months after Delphi’s birth and Narcissa Hides Delphi away without telling Draco who till this day is looking for his niece. At the same time in new heaven Orphanage Delphi is eleven year old and waiting for her acceptence letter from Eton when she is mistreated and punished while the rest of the children leave for picnic. Later Sister Anne who is a nun tells Delphi that her letters were stole by Madam Mastigia and are hidden in her office. Delphi breaks into the office with the help of magic but she caught by another nun

A Snowy Night

It was a cold winter night the snow fell silently on the ground and the sky was covered with thick grey clouds. Throughout the neighbourhood not a single soul was awake the people of Little Hexham slept deeply lost in their dreams un aware that something far more magical was taking place in the shadowy streets.

At the corner of the street stood a man in a black cloak waiting for someone nervously looking around and jumping at the smallest sounds as if he was here to commit a crime. Well as a matter of fact he was here to commit a horrible crime which in the eyes of ordinary Muggles would be considered a noble task but the Wizarding World especially the Ministry of Magic would not forgive such a crime, the crime of saving a child and putting it into the care of an orphanage nun.

The wizard werewolf named Argos Noir stood with one hand inside his cloak holding his wand firmly as though he feared to be caught seeing alone lurking. Suddenly there is a sound like a whoosh of a wind the from the other end of the street. The man turns around searching for the source of the sound and he sees the shadowy figure of a women wearing a black cloak one hand holding a basket, the other hand tucking a golden chain under her robes visible under the light from the street lamps.

She spots the Argos and addresses him in a clear hushed voice holding out her own wand at him threateningly.

"If you are who I expect you to be and are here to fulfil the task that you were ordered to do prove it"

The Argos Noir hears these words and roles up the sleeve of his left arm, there visible is a mark of a serpent and a skull etched in his skin.

"I believe it is your turn" said the Argos in a raspy voice.

"Fair enough' replied the women evenly rolling up her own sleeve and showing a similar mark.

The Argos lowers his wand.

"My Lady it's a pleasure to be at your service' je says addressing the woman named Narcissa Malfoy.

"It means a lot hearing it from you most of others would have fled or turned us in by now" said Nrcissa gratefully.

"My Lady a faithful servant can never betray the hand that fed him when non did" Argos said with bow. Then continued firmly "Now let's get to the point may I ask where the child is?

"Here in the basket." Said Narcissa Malfoy showing a small basket which had a baby girl with silver and blue hair wrapped in blankets fast asleep, a small round golden locket with Delphine flower design and an emerald was around her neck. The man noticed this and inquired.

"Pardon me I was wondering if a child should be given such a n expensive trinket, it can attract trouble."

"It was her mother's last wish that she keeps it, it is a family heirloom." Replied Narcissa slightly saddened by the mention of the late mother.

"Well if that's the case I understand come let's get inside." Said Argos and walked up to the Orphanage building with Narcissa at his side.

"About that I need to ask you Do you really trust this woman with such a n important task? Mind you I am not very found of Squibs" remarked Narcissa slightly annoyed and worried.

"She is a stiff woman of God but she does has a heart and can be trusted as long as paid well. And besides we know her weakness." replied the Argos positively.

"I don't like the sound of that but it's not like I have much of a choice." Said Narcissa with a sigh.

"Knock Knock" the sound echoed in the quite air as they knocked on the Orphanage door.

A young nun opened it and asked "Yes how may I help you?"

"We are looking for Madam Mastigia" replied Argos.

"Yes she is expecting you let me take you to her study" said the young nun taking them to the head nun's study.

Argos and Narcissa Malfoy walk up the narrow dimly lit hall. The orphanage consists of an old British building with flickering lamps and the wall paper is peeling off from places. The floor is clean though cracked and rough looking. The young nun opens a door and leads them in.

"Good evening please have a seat" said the whizzy woman in her thirties with flat black hair and round bulging brown eyes with a mole on her right check. She was standing by the book self near her desk " would you like a cup of tea it is really cold out there?"

"Thank you but I had enough of formalities, I would like to make the matter as clear as I can." Said Narcissa Malfoy with an firm air of a queen giving orders while Argos Noir stood leaning next to the gate slightly showing his pointed teeth in order to frighten her.

"Proceed". Said the head nun sitting on the chair behind her desk.

"This child will be kept in this Orphanage for safe keeping not adoption. Safe keeping " She said pointing at the basket the baby Delphini was in which she had placed on the desk and continued.

" All her expenses will be covered by my family. She will be raised and educated in the most suitable manner for a lady. But above all she will be kept healthy and happy. She is not to be told anything about her heritage, or connection with my family. She will attend Hogwarts at the age of 11 and will study there until she turns 18 and then and only then she can be told about us. Is that all clear?" She asked leaving no room for doubt however the head nun was a bit annoyed.

"Hold on a little madam you said she is not to be told about her family heritage or you, so what will I tell her when she turns 18 as I know nothing about who this girl is?" she inquired annoyed and slightly confused .

"And also I have few questions about this child's peculiar appearance and how she is connected to you. If she is who I think she is," she said with a narrowed eye look at the child.

"You know even we Squibs hear rumours surrounding the Wizarding World, then why would I ever agree to keep her and not turn her in." She finished with a sly smile causing the werewolf Argos to growl and glare at the women threateningly.

"You will do no such thing because of a number of important reasons." Said Narcissa again in a silky sweet threatening voice.

"That being?" she asked doubtfully.

"The first being that you will be paid a fortune for this task. And your secret about your own criminal deeds will not be exposed---"

"What do you mean?" she tried to deny but Narcissa continued.

"lastly if you told another soul about this I will give you a death worse than hell. We will form an unbreakable vow."

"I will do no such thing" refused angrily standing up and causing her chair to fall.

At this Narcissa Malfoy fired a revealing spell at the bookshelf which fell with a thud revealing a small room containing old magical artefacts, narcotic herbs, and stolen money from the Orphanage donations and smuggler wizards.

"If you don't want to be sent to Azkaban It would be best to accept my offer besides you are getting paid aren't you." Said Narcissa taking out her wand and placing it's burning tip at the nun's heart.

The nun looked extremely scared at the revelation of her crimes so she said with a resigned to the worst expression "Fine now tell who this child is. Is she really the daughter of Dark Lord and Bellatrix Listrange "

"Your had guessed quite right, she is the dark lord daughter however her mother was my niece Dahlia, Dahlia was Bella's Squib daughter an illegitimate child. She died in child birth and left this locket with the child as an heirloom. Her silver and blue hair are the cause of a mutation." Told Narcissa in an offhand manner.

"You can't be serious I was only kidding about the Voldemort part. Do you really think that this child will not be found here. The Ministry will know when she uses magic." Asked the nun now worried of getting caught.

"The Ministry will only know that an unrigestered orphaned witch is here however they will not suspect her as Lord Voldemort's daughter as the child they are looking for should be seven years old by now but this child is only a few months old." Said Narcissa with a proud satisfied smile.

The head nun realized truly for the first time what she was seeing and asked. "How is that possible, unless unless-" and the realisation of the impossible hit her like thunderbolt.

--But that can't be true all the time turners were smashed years ago there are non left." She finished horror struck.

"Don't think too much about things that do no concern you. Just do as your told take care of the child and make sure she is happy and safe." Advice Narcissa Malfoy with a deadly look daring the old woman to defy her. The werewolf Argos also came and stood in front of her bearing all his teeth.

"Now if you don't want to die I suggest we form a vow." She suggested and Argos took out his wand,

Madam Mastigia vowed to take care of Delphini Riddle and after a bit of tedious paperwork and some more instructions from Mrs. Malfoy. It was time to say goodbye.

Narcissa bent down and kissed the child on the forehead a small tear falling from her eye. With a deep breath she calmed herself and said to the child in a hushed loving voice of a mother. "Take care my sweet child, be brave one day I will see you again. Goodbye."

And with that final pat on Delphi's head she left the orphanage. Argos Noir was by her side he bid Narcissa goodbye and Apparated. Narcissa took out the Time Turner around her neck and turned it backwards and with a last longing look at the Orphanage and a whispered goodbye Narcissa Malfoy disappeared with the whoosh of a wind.

Delphi Riddle was taken to the baby's nursery and placed in a cradle sleeping soundly without a worry in the world not knowing that her fate was filled with dark secrets and magic, Not knowing that even right now people in the Wizarding World shuddered in fear whenever they talked about the idea of her existence the existence of the cursed child
